Definitions:

Informal Roles

Unofficial positions within a group or organization, shaped by individual interactions and behaviors, rather than assigned or formally recognized duties.

Designated Roles

Specific functions or positions assigned to individuals in a group, organization, or event.

Assigned Roles

Specific functions or parts allocated to individuals in a group or team setting, often meant to guide behavior and responsibilities.

Normative Influence

A social mechanism where individuals change their behavior to align with the norms or expectations of a group.
